Gervonta Davis: why is he called ‘Tank’?
Like many boxers who train in boxing gyms or possess unique attributes, Gervonta Davis has acquired a nickname. Davis was given the moniker “Tank” by one of his coaches due to his disproportionately large head compared to his body.

The nickname fits the boxer, as he consistently dominates his opponents with his impressive power and aggressive style. While some fighters change their nicknames based on their in-ring accomplishments, fighting style, or personal preference, Davis’ nickname has remained the same.
On the other hand, Floyd Mayweather Jr., who signed Davis when he began his professional career, is an excellent example of a boxer who changed his nickname over time. Mayweather started his career as “Pretty Boy” but eventually adopted the nicknames “TBE” (The Best Ever) and “Money” due to the vast sums of money he earned throughout his career.
